Scriptural examples: So Judah and Israel lived securely, everyone under his vine and his fig tree, from Dan even to Beersheba, all the days of Solomon. 1 Kings 4:25 WebDec 13, 2024 · The fig (Heb. תְּאֵנָה, te'enah) is part of the Seven Species (שבעת המינים, Shiv'at HaMinim) that were the staple foods consumed in the Land of Israel in Biblical times. These 7 species are; wheat, barley, grape, fig, pomegranates, olive (oil), and date (honey) (Deuteronomy 8:8). These Seven Species are considered special ...
